Coating aluminum presents a unique set of challenges, particularly in the pretreatment stage. A client in the architectural window and door frame market needed an electrophoresis coating production line to provide a durable primer for their aluminum extrusions. A standard zinc or iron phosphate process is not effective on aluminum. Leveraging our deep process knowledge, we designed a system with a specialized multi-stage pretreatment process using a chrome-free conversion coating specifically formulated for aluminum alloys. This created the perfect surface for the subsequent cathodic E-coat to form a tenacious bond. This specialized TIMS electrophoresis coating production line gave their products the robust foundation needed to withstand decades of outdoor exposure without peeling or blistering, a critical requirement in the architectural industry.
